Otherproblems
Charging is difficult in places subject to extremely
high/low temperatures.
-).To protect the battery, it is recommended
to
charge it in places with a temperature
of 10°C to
35°C (50°F to 90°F), (
pg. 43)
The battery pack is not attached firmly.
-).Detach the battery pack once again and re-attach
it firmly. (
pg. 11)

• The LCD monitor and the viewfinder are made
with high-precision
technology.
However, black
spots or bright spots of light (red, green or blue)
may appear constantly on the LCD monitor or the
viewfinder.
These spots are not recorded on the
tape. This is not due to any defect of the unit.
(Effective dots: more than 99.99 %)
